Girlypop emerges from the unlikely collaboration between two Gemini Risings with an Aquarius Midheaven. Separated by a vast ocean, they found ways to collaborate online and create eurodance-inspired tracks. Their shared love for techno, raves, breakbeat, and all things cool is reflected in the fresh music they make. youyousolo and nicenora are both originally from Mexico, and after a few months of separation, they are now both based in Ireland, where Girlypop has found its home.
Girlypop’s first single, “missing pangea,” was released on February 6 across streaming platforms. It is a eurodance track that combines the creative minds of nicenora and youyousolo. nicenora delivers vocals with lyrics that evoke the existential dread of realizing that traditional ways of experiencing life, and especially partnerships, are becoming obsolete. As people are increasingly encouraged, and sometimes forced, to move across the globe in pursuit of their dreams. She presents these vocals in a high-energy glitchpop style and introduces synths inspired by hyperpop.
youyousolo crafts the track’s impetuous drums and bass, giving it a bounce that drives listeners to the dancefloor by blending elements of eurotrance and house music. In “missing pangea,” youyousolo creates a distinctly modern Age-of-Aquarius atmosphere by structuring the track in a way reminiscent of old-school dance music.
Girlypop’s next single will be released as the sun warms the Northern Hemisphere. Titled “crisis,” it continues the conceptual thread of “missing pangea,” where existentialism meets nihilism, but with hope, represented by a catchy, bouncy eurodance backdrop. For now, Girlypop’s focus is on entering the European music scene through late-night DJ sets, while daylight hours are dedicated to creating a debut EP that musically represents the headspace of global humanity.
